Poincar\'e invariant representation of the spin in quantum theory
Teoretičeskaâ i matematičeskaâ fizika, Tome 51 (1982) no. 3, pp. 327-334
Voir la notice de l'article provenant de la source Math-Net.Ru
It is shown that there exist two equivalent Poincaré-invariant representations of the
spin – in vector and tensor forms. All Poincaré-invariant spin operators of Dirac
particles are classified on this basis.
